An Economist has described the performance of the Kwacha against the United States dollar as being stable in the last week of the month of August 2019.
Mr. Mambo Hamaundu observes that there has been marginal fluctuation in the exchange rate market with the Kwacha gaining slightly against other foreign convertible currencies.
Mr. Hamaundu attributes this to economic factors that prevailed during the course of the week.
The US dollar is buying at twelve ninety-seven ngwee and selling at thirteen Kwacha twenty-two ngwee.
The British pound is buying at fifteen-kwacha eighty-three ngwee and selling at sixteen Kwacha thirteen ngwee.
The Euro is buying at fourteen -kwacha thirty-six ngwee and selling at fourteen-kwacha sixty-four ngwee.
And the South African Rand is buying at eighty-five ngwee and selling at eighty-six ngwee.
